The jboss xsd allows for the jndi-binding-policy to be configured outside of the
enterprise-beans section. This jndi-binding-policy should then be applied to all beans in
the enterprise-beans section. However, this doesn't happen. The following jboss.xml: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<!-- $Id: jboss.xml 68870 2008-01-11 09:47:56Z wolfc $ -->
<jboss
xmlns="http://www.jboss.com/xml/ns/javaee"
xmlns:jee="http://java.sun.com/xml/ns/javaee"
x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"
xsi:schemaLocation="http://www.jboss.com/xml/ns/javaee
http://www.jboss.org/j2ee/schema/jboss_5_0.xsd"
version="5.0">
<jndi-binding-policy>org.jboss.metadata.ejb.test.jndibindingpolicy.DummyPolicy</jndi-binding-policy>
<enterprise-beans>
<session>
<ejb-name>DummyBean</ejb-name>
</session>
</enterprise-beans>
</jboss>
when converted to metadata return null jndi-binding-policy for the DummyBean.
P.S: Note that the jndi-binding-policy probably makes more sense in assembly-descriptor
section (as Carlo pointed out on IRC today) of the jboss.xml. So i guess, this might be
the time to move it to assembly-descriptor section?
